In this role, you will be at the intersection of hardware prototyping, robotics and software. You will design and build the physical test infrastructure - fixtures, multi-axis alignment rigs, and automated stages- that lets engineering teams verify sensor performance on XR hardware. You will also build the software that drives it: full-stack tools that control robotic testing and validation setup, capture data, and turn raw measurements into actionable results, and the setups are built to be scalable to be used by internal partners and external vendors. You are equally comfortable at a CAD workstation, a Python terminal, and an optical bench — and can translate a one-off lab setup into a documented, scalable system that other teams and AI-assisted tooling can build on.

Responsibilities

  • Design custom optomechanical test fixtures and multi-axis motion control setups using 3D prototyping and rigorous mechanical alignment tolerances to validate AR/VR hardware.
  • Develop full-stack software and automated calibration pipelines for camera intrinsics, extrinsics, and display alignment using Python and computer vision.
  • Perform optical alignment and validation using reference targets, camera-based self-alignment, and automated simulation scripts prior to physical builds.
  • Leverage AI-assisted development tools to build scalable automation software and document reusable test frameworks across future hardware programs.
  • Partner cross-functionally with optics, mechanical, firmware, and manufacturing teams to transition lab-validated methods into scalable, production-ready infrastructure.
